About the Opportunity In-House Mechanic & Road Tech for Construction Equipment - Road-equipment mechanic Analyzes malfunctions and repairs, rebuilds, and maintains construction equipment, for example skid loaders, lifts, paving machines, trench-digging machines, conveyors, excavates, dredges, pumps, compressors and pneumatic tools: Operates and inspects machines or equipment to diagnose defects. Dismantles and reassembles equipment, using hoists and hand tools. Examines parts for damage or excessive wear, using micrometers and gauges. Replaces defective engines and sub assemblies, for example transmissions. Tests overhauled equipment to ensure operating efficiency. Welds broken parts and structural members. May also direct workers engaged in cleaning parts and assisting with assembly and disassembly of equipment. May also repair, adjust, and maintain various other pieces of equipment. Will also visit customer job sites and perform routine maintenance, troubleshoot, and repair construction equipment. HVAC/Refrigeration Technician 5 year experience required

Job Description Job Description Performs a variety of standard to moderately complex technical tasks related to installing, maintaining, and repairing heating, cooling, ventilation, and related systems as follows: Core Technical Skills Installation, service, and repair of commercial and/or residential HVAC systems Installation and troubleshooting of refrigeration systems (walk‐ins, reach‐ins, ice machines, chillers, etc.) Ability to read schematics, wiring diagrams, and technical manuals Skilled in brazing, soldering, evacuating, charging, and leak detection Proficiency with diagnostic tools (manifold gauges, multimeters, vacuum pumps, recovery machines) Understanding of airflow, load calculations, and system performance testing Knowledge of controls, including thermostats, relays, contactors, and VFDs Installation of HVAC ductwork including flexible tubing and sheet metal construction Install or repair electrical connections to HVAC components Experience Requirements High school diploma or GED Clean and valid Florida driver’s license 5 years of hands‐on HVAC/R field experience (not general maintenance) Proven experience with commercial refrigeration (required) Experience performing preventive maintenance, but with a focus on technical service and repair, not general building upkeep Ability to work independently on service calls, diagnostics, and system commissioning Physical & Work Environment Requirements Ability to lift 50–75 lbs Comfortable working in hot attics, rooftops, confined spaces, and cold storage environments Ability to climb ladders, work on rooftops, and use power tools safely Compliance & Safety Knowledge of OSHA safety standards Compliance with EPA refrigerant handling regulations Proper documentation of refrigerant recovery and service records Professional Competencies Strong problem‐solving and diagnostic skills Clear communication with customers and dispatch Ability to complete service tickets, estimates, and reports Reliable, punctual, and able to work on‐call rotations if required Working Conditions: Moderate physical effort that requires long periods of standing, bending, stooping, periodic lifting of moderately heavy items and routine discomfort from exposure to moderate levels of heat, cold, moisture and air pollution.
